LOUISVILLE, Ky. — Police have arrested a Louisville-area man accused of committing multiple armed robberies.
Jeffersontown Police took 24-year-old Chad Harlamert into custody on Thursday. He faces charges of robbery and possession of a firearm by a prohibited person.
Authorities say Harlamert first robbed a Walgreens pharmacy on Tuesday, brandishing a gun at the counter and demanding two bottles of Xanax, which the pharmacist provided. Harlamert then fled in a white Ford EcoSport.
A couple of days later, Harlamert allegedly robbed Miso’s Game Room and Collectibles on Citadel Way.
During a search of his home, police recovered:
-
Clothing worn during the Walgreens robbery
-
The two bottles of Xanax
-
A Ruger .22 caliber revolver
-
Five collectible figurines from Miso’s
-
The vehicle used in the Walgreens robbery
Harlamert remains in police custody as investigations continue.
